Wednesday, August 29, 2007

Big Can of Whoopass

Defense Industry Daily is one to watch if you are interested in loud noises.
This pic, courtesy of the fine folks at DID is of an M1 Abrams settling a firefight in beautiful downtown metropolitan Fallujah.
It gives new meaning to the concept of search and seizure, doesn't it?


